What is a CNA?
A Certified Nursing Assistant (CNA) provides essential support to nurses and patients in healthcare settings, including hospitals, nursing homes, and assisted living facilities. CNAs perform various duties such as:
- Assisting patients with daily activities
- Monitoring patient’s vital signs
- Providing basic care and comfort
- Communicating patient needs to nursing staff
The Benefits of becoming a CNA
Choosing to become a CNA comes with numerous advantages, including:
- High Demand: The healthcare industry is rapidly growing, leading to a consistent demand for CNAs.
- Flexible Hours: Many facilities offer flexible work schedules, making it easier to balance work and personal life.
- foundation for Advancement: CNA experience can lead to further education and advancement opportunities in nursing and other healthcare fields.
- Personal Fulfillment: Helping others can be incredibly rewarding, both personally and professionally.

How to Choose the Right CNA School
Selecting a CNA school that fits your needs is essential. consider these factors:
- Accreditation: Ensure the program is accredited and recognized by relevant state and federal agencies.
- Curriculum: Review the curriculum to ensure it covers necessary skills and knowledge areas.
- Hands-On Training: Look for programs that offer practical experience through clinical rotations.
- Flexibility: Choose a school that accommodates your schedule, especially if you have other commitments.
- Job Placement Assistance: Some schools offer job placement services to help you land a job post-graduation.
Practical Tips for Success in CNA School
Once you’ve enrolled in a CNA program,consider these practical tips to help you succeed:
- Stay Organized: Keep track of assignments,exams,and clinical hours.
- Ask Questions: Don’t hesitate to seek clarification from instructors on complex topics.
- Practice Skills: Utilize lab time and extra practice to hone your skills.
- Network: Build relationships with instructors and peers, wich can help in finding job opportunities after graduation.
